Features

There are various water-related phobic disorders, among which the most prominent is bathophobia. This fear is associated with a fear of depth and is one of the manifestations of the fear of death. Kinds

Fear of depth is divided into two main categories.

  • Objective - with her, a person is really in danger. For example, when it fell into a whirlpool and could be tightened to the depth from minute to minute. Also, an objective fear of depth may arise if a vessel carrying people is in serious danger. Then a sense of self-preservation is triggered, and general panic begins on the deck.
  • Destructive a phobia appears as a result of obsessive thoughts that may arise when an individual is at depth. Keeping well afloat, a person suddenly begins to model various negative situations and thereby winds himself up. For example, it seems to him that during the voyage he will start a cramp, and he will quickly sink.

In other cases, after watching various programs that tell about floods, the individual, sitting at home on the couch, imagines that now an uncontrollable wave will cover him.As a result of his invented phobia, he begins to fight hysterically, and this attack is quite difficult to stop.

This case is the most difficult. And if such manifestations are observed, it is necessary to seek help from a specialist.

Symptoms

In severe phobias, fear of fear of water may appear even when there is no reservoir nearby. It is just that a person gradually begins to wind himself up and present the negative consequences of what is able to get into the center of the whirlpool. This individual turns non-existent moments in his mind, develops the severity of the problem instead of calming down.

As a result of such actions, the batophobe organism starts a process that provokes the release of a huge amount of adrenaline. The brain can't handle it. The result of this is the failure of all systems of the human body. Further changes occur, provoking the following symptoms:

  • breathing becomes intermittent;
  • dizziness and severe headache may begin;
  • pressure jumps occur - it either increases significantly or decreases;
  • tormenting thirst;
  • there is nausea or lump to the throat;
  • sweating of arms and legs increases significantly;
  • there is often double vision in the eyes;
  • disorientation in space begins.

These manifestations are very dangerous to the health and life of the patient, so it is necessary to take measures to eliminate the phobia and to establish the work of the whole organism.

Methods for getting rid of phobias

To overcome phobic disorders can be in different ways.

Psychotherapist help

To treat a phobia is necessary only with the help of an experienced therapist, who will first identify the cause of fear, and then select an individual therapy.

  • Hypnotherapy. It implies psychotherapeutic work with a person who is imposed on an altered state, and then his mind is subjected to external suggestion. Hypnologist inspires man that he no longer fears depth.
  • C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) is a form of psychotherapy. It lies in the fact that psychological problems and neuropsychological disorders are changed with the help of joint and specific work of a specialist and a patient. Batofob tells his fears, and the doctor corrects his thoughts with the help of a special technique.
  • Autotraining It also helps to relax the mind of a person and tune in to positive.
  • Neuro-linguistic programming - It is a part of practical psychology that develops applied techniques that learn from the experience of psychotherapists and masters of communication. Verbal suggestions can make the individual no longer afraid of the deep waters.
  • If the disease is serious and has a neglected form, then drug therapy is prescribed. Only this question should be solved by an experienced specialist, otherwise uncontrolled medication will lead to unforeseen consequences.
